Technical Description AL ED ED FPALDED Description of the function When override is activated via digital input The drive stops loads the predefined override parameter set into use and then accelerates to the preset or PID controlled speed or frequency When override is active e f override reference is constant P1707 CONSTANT o Drive runs at preset speed frequency e or if the source for the override reference is PID1 output P1707 PID o Drive runs at speed frequency defined by the PID1 controller e Drive ignores all keypad commands Drive ignores all commands from communication links e Drive ignores all digital inputs except DI1 DI6 when used for deactivation of override functionality P1701 OVERRIDE SEL when used for controlling the motor rotation direction P1706 OVERRIDE DIR when used as a source of the RUN ENABLE signal P1601 RUN ENABLE when used as a source of the START ENABLE signals P1608 START ENABLE 1 and P1609 START ENABLE 2 e Drive ignores all analog inputs except Al1 Al2 o When used for PID1 set point P1707 OVERRIDE REF PID Drive displays alarm message 2020 OVERRIDE MODE e Drive handles the fault situations as described in the section Fault handling in override mode 0000 When override is deactivated via digital input The drive stops and reboots If the start command run enable and start enables are active in the AUTO mode the drive starts automatically and continues nor

9. mally after override mode In the HAND mode the drive returns to OFF mode Commissioning of the override mode Enter values of all parameters as needed Select the digital input that will activate override mode P1701 OVERRIDE SEL Select the source for the frequency or speed reference P1707 OVERRIDE REF Select the digital input that will define the motor rotation direction or define the fixed direction P1706 OVERRIDE REF 5 Enter the frequency or speed reference for override mode P1702 and P1703 according to the motor control mode P9904 see note 1 Note Frequency or speed reference has no effect if PID is used as a source of the reference P1707 PID Enter the pass code P1704 OVERRIDE PASS CODE pass code 358 Enable the override mode P1705 OVERRIDE ENABLE Test the functionality of the override mode and make changes when necessary see changing the override parameters PON gt coo N Note 1 The following conditions must be met for avoiding parameterizationOverrSSpecific B error fault code 1011 e If the source for the override reference is PID1 output P1707 OVERRIDE REF PID o _PID1 set point P4010 must be either Al1 Al2 or INTERNAL o PID1 parameter set 1 must be active P4027 SET 1 o Override direction P1706 must be either FORWARD 0 or REVERSE 7 e Ifthe override reference is constant P1707 OVERRIDE REF CONSTANT o Frequency reference must be gt 0 Hz if motor control mode P9904 is SCALAR
